  • Positioning India as the Food Bowl of the World by Equipping Farmers with Data-Driven Tech: Fasal’s Shailendra Tiwari
    2026/03/26

    Agtech innovation isn't only about planting new seeds, it's about giving farmers access to the right data at the right time. Fasal (translation: “crop”), a precision horticulture tech company based in Bangalore, India, is tackling one of the biggest obstacles for growers: tackling the guesswork inherent in farming.

    Season 2 of the BCV Podcast continues with a wide-ranging conversation with Shailendra Tiwari, Founder and CEO of Fasal, a deep-tech company building farm intelligence and automation systems for reliable, scalable agriculture. Beyond Capital Ventures Managing Partner Eva Yazhari, Partner Nicholas Java, and Partner Christophe de Montile spoke with Shailendra about how Fasal is using IoT, AI, and real-time insights to drive farmer productivity, outcomes, and sustainability.

    Key takeaways from Episode 3:


    • Shailendra describes Fasal’s value statement: Helping to enable India’s farmers to make precise decisions to maximize their productivity and output at scale and address much of the unpredictability that farming presents (2:05)
    • Shailendra delves into his personal, serendipitous reasons for forming Fasal (3:05)
    • How access to deep crop data—from fertilization to irrigation to pest control—stabilizes and streamlines operations for farmers around the world, removing irregularity and increasing outcomes (6:20)
    • Nicholas introduces the concept of agriculture vs. horticulture across Southeast Asia and how each benefit farming communities and economies in different ways (9:26)
    • The nexus between India and Africa: Beyond Capital Ventures’ areas of focus and these emerging markets as the epicenters of global growth (13:51)
    • How Shailendra and the Fasal team are positioning the company to define rather than react to the next wave of change in the agriculture industry (15:58)
    • The biggest misconception about Indian farmers that drives Shailendra bananas (no pun intended) (23:51)

  • Ampersand’s Alper Tilev on Treading the Fine Line Between Delivering Electric Mobility in Emerging Markets—While Saving Drivers Money
    2026/03/12

    Season 2 of the BCV Podcast continues with an energizing conversation with Alper Tilev, Co-Founder and CTO of Ampersand, Africa’s leading EV energy tech company. Ampersand has created a world where motorcycle transport is cleaner and more profitable for customers than ever before by building a commercial e-motorcycle fleet and battery swapping network at scale.


    Beyond Capital Ventures Managing Partner Eva Yazhari and Partner Nicholas Java are joined in this episode by Partner and Nairobi-based Africa lead Christophe de Montille to discuss Ampersand’s impact on the continent’s environment, economy, and livelihoods. The talk also veers into the e-mobility tech trends that will continue to disrupt and define the marketplace.


    Self-driving bikes? It remains to be seen, but, for now, Ampersand is focused on the limitless road ahead.


    Some don’t-miss moments from this high-octane conversation:


    • Alp discusses the key drivers that differentiate Ampersand from competitors that came before. (4:03)
    • Why being based in Kigali is essential to understanding Ampersand’s customer base, ensuring their voices are heard and the product developments meet their needs (5:01)
    • Eva explains how BCV’s relational approach to investing aligns with Ampersand’s customer-centric approach. (5:42)
    • What motivates the Ampersand customer beyond the environmental impact and how the company delivers on that promise (6:16)
    • Why the fallacy of the cheapest product always wins in emerging markets isn’t only false—that race to the bottom means missing major opportunities (8:05)
    • The critical role data plays in every Ampersand decision and how AI factors into the company’s future operational efficiencies and excellence (11:24)
    • What investors are missing out on if they’re not investing alongside BCV in companies like Ampersand that are defining the future of emerging markets (19:32)
    • Eva distills how empathy—listening to customers, building intentional technology, collecting data, lowering costs, entering new markets, and replicating the business model faithfully—creates a path for founders looking to build their own solutions. (28:01)

  • Season 2 Premiere: Viebeg CEO Alex Rosen on How Data Helps Solve One of Africa’s Biggest Healthcare Challenges
    2026/02/26

    Welcome to Season 2 of the BCV Podcast! Beyond Capital Ventures Managing Partner Eva Yazhari and Venture Partner Nicholas Java are here this episode to spotlight the founders reshaping emerging markets and share the deals you wish you didn’t miss. Each episode will broaden your understanding of investment and inspire you to envision new possibilities for what capital can achieve.


    In our Season 2 premiere, Eva and Nicholas sit down with Viebeg CEO Alex Rosen, who explores his company’s visionary tech-forward and data-driven approach to solving one of Africa’s biggest healthcare challenges: reliable access to life-saving medical supplies and equipment.


    Some key takeaways from our conversation:


    • How Viebeg is using data to deliver impact at scale, utilize predictive maintenance, and disrupt the healthcare industry in Africa (1:48)
    • Why working directly with quantitative data from Africa’s Ministry of Health is key to helping guide medical clinics to make smart, strategic decisions about diagnostic equipment, enabling them to be more effective and profitable (5:40)
    • How Viebeg’s revolutionary and easily repeatable and scalable “clinic-in-a-box” model is allowing the company to move swiftly and confidently into new markets throughout the continent—including those in politically unstable regions (10:36)
    • Why partnering with NGOs is a critical part of Viebeg’s growth across all parts the Continent (12:06)
    • All of the ways AI plays an essential role in Viebeg’s overall tech-forward strategy and success by facilitating patients’ connections with medical practitioners, especially in rural areas (13:05)
    • In one sentence, why people would wish they had joined Viebeg’s journey sooner (26:25)
    • Alex takes part in the BCV Podcast lightning round, including questions about the biggest misconception about the healthcare market, the biggest company milestone Viebeg is currently racing toward, and the one mistake his team is aiming to avoid (26:34)
